Manchester United are set to raise their bid for Patrick Dorgu to €37-38 million in an effort to finalize the transfer of the 20-year-old left wingback this week. Lecce currently value Dorgu at €40 million and have previously rejected United’s offers of £23 million and £28 million. Despite this, United remain optimistic that the increased offer will seal the deal, having already reached a preliminary agreement on a five-year contract with the player. Meanwhile, Lecce are reportedly preparing for Dorgu’s departure, with Danilo Veiga of Portuguese side Estrela Amadora lined up as his replacement.
